224. How Ditching Alcohol Helped Sumner Brooks Live Life Fully and Parent With Presence


Listen Later

“I really felt like alcohol was the one thing that was keeping me from being the person that I wanted to be."

If you’ve ever wondered how alcohol might be impacting your ability to show up fully in your life, or if you’re just curious about making any change that feels a little scary, this episode is for you. I sat down with Sumner Brooks, a registered dietitian, mom, and author of How to Raise an Intuitive Eater, who bravely shares her story of quitting alcohol and how it changed everything from her mental health to her parenting and beyond.

While we usually focus on food and body image on Diet Culture Rebel, today we zoom out to explore what it means to get curious about anything that might be getting in the way of living your fullest, most connected life. Sumner opens up about what finally made sobriety "stick” for her after years of trying, how vulnerability paved the way for real change, and the actual joy and presence she discovered in sobriety.

We also talk about how ingrained alcohol is in our daily lives and our culture, what it looks like to navigate those familiar “Why aren’t you drinking?” comments, and where food and alcohol are similar (and importantly, different) when it comes to compulsion, habituation, and addiction. Sumner’s story is a powerful reminder that even if everything looks fine on the outside, you’re allowed to want more peace and presence on the inside.

No matter what you’re working on - food, alcohol, or something entirely different - I invite you to go into this episode with curiosity and self-compassion. Sometimes, you don’t even know when you need to hear something until you do.

What You’ll Learn:

  • How Sumner realized alcohol was keeping her from showing up in the life she worked so hard to build
  • The role of vulnerability and community storytelling in making big life changes
  • Why “mommy wine culture” is so normalized, and how that intersects with diet culture’s mixed messages about food and alcohol
  • How reading other women’s stories helped Sumner finally quit drinking for good
  • How sobriety changed Sumner’s relationship with herself, her parenting, and her ability to be fully present
  • The real differences between intuitive eating and “intuitive drinking”, and why abstinence from alcohol is not the same as cutting out foods
